This easy recipe for teriyaki chicken comes together with very little hands on time - while you let the slow cooker do all the work!

Ingredients
1 1/2lbsbonelessskinless chicken breasts
1tablespoongrated ginger
1/2cupteriyaki glazenot teriyaki sauce
1heaping tablespoon orange marmalade
2clovesgrated or minced garlic
2tablespoonswater
1tablespooncornstarch
1tablespoontoasted sesame seeds
prepared ricefor serving
Instructions
Spray a 3 1/2-4 quart slow cooker with nonstick cooking spray. Put the chicken breasts in the bottom of the slow cooker.
In a small bowl, combine the ginger, teriyaki glaze, orange marmalade and garlic. Mix well and pour over the chicken.
Cook on low for 6 hours, or until the chicken is cooked through.
Remove the chicken to a plate and shred or cut into bite-sized pieces. Pour the liquid into a saucepan. Return the chicken to the slow cooker.
In a small bowl, combine the 2 tablespoons of water and 1 tablespoon of cornstarch. Add to the pan with the liquid. Cook over medium-high heat until the liquid has thickened, then pour back into the slow cooker and stir to coat the chicken. Stir in the sesame seeds.
Serve over prepared rice.
Notes
*Note - different slow cookers cook at different temperatures. Start checking your chicken earlier for doneness if yours cooks faster.*
